What is baseline measurement?

In workplace health and safety, a baseline study is one that looks at study characteristics at a particular time or under a particular set of conditions to establish a "base line." This could be the incidence rate of a particular condition, the airborne concentration of a contaminant, or any of a number of other items. Subsequent studies of the same or similar workplaces at different times or under different circumstances will be conducted to see if there are changes as compared to that "base line." Then the researcher will attempt to determine whether the changes were related to any of the differing circumstances.

What is the importance of base line in chain surveying?

This term is often used in Chain Surveying, The longest of the chain lines formed in doing a survey is generally regarded as the base line.It is the most important line in doing survey .The framework of the whole survey built up on the base line as it fixes up the direction of all other lines.It should be measured with great accuracy and precision .For accuracy The base line should be measured twice or thrice.


How is a reference dimension shown on a drawing?

A reference dimension is a dimension that is not crucial for the effective use of the part. Reference dimensions are not inspected.A reference dimension may also be a dimension that is shown elsewhere in the drawing but is shown in the current view to help clarify the position of other features in the view. This practice eliminates "double-dimensioning" which is not acceptable in drafting standards.

3. What is the difference between chain dimensioning and datum dimensioning?

Chain dimensioning involves placing dimensions in a linear sequence, where each dimension is referenced from the previous one, which can lead to cumulative tolerances and potential inaccuracies. In contrast, datum dimensioning establishes a reference point or surface (datum) from which all other dimensions are measured, ensuring consistency and precision across the entire part. This method reduces the accumulation of tolerances and enhances the reliability of the dimensions. Overall, datum dimensioning is generally preferred for critical applications where accuracy is paramount.

What is contour dimensioning?

Contour dimensioning is a method of dimensioning a part by specifying the lengths of its contours or outlines. It provides an overall description of the part's shape and size without specifying the individual dimensions of every feature. This method is often used for parts with complex shapes where detailing every dimension would be impractical.


What does over- dimensioning mean?

Over-dimensioning refers to the practice of designing or specifying components, structures, or systems with dimensions or capacities that exceed the actual requirements for their intended use. This can lead to increased costs, unnecessary weight, and inefficient use of materials. While it may enhance safety or durability, over-dimensioning can result in waste and may not be the most effective approach in terms of resource management. Balancing safety and functionality is crucial to avoid over-dimensioning.
